使用mysqldump命令导出单张表

在MySQL数据库中,有时候我们需要导出数据库中的单张表,这时候就可以使用 mysqldump 命令来实现。mysqldump 是 MySQL 提供的一个用于备份数据库的工具,它可以将数据库的结构和数据导出为 SQL 脚本。

导出单张表的步骤

  1. 打开终端或命令行工具,输入以下命令:
mysqldump -u 用户名 -p 数据库名 表名 > 导出文件名.sql
  • -u 用户名:指定数据库用户名
  • -p:提示输入数据库密码
  • 数据库名:要导出的数据库名
  • 表名:要导出的表名
  • 导出文件名.sql:导出的 SQL 脚本文件名
  1. 输入密码后,系统会自动生成一个 SQL 脚本文件,其中包含了要导出的表的结构和数据。

代码示例

假设我们有一个名为 users 的表,包含了用户的信息。现在我们要导出这张表的内容,可以使用以下命令:

mysqldump -u root -p mydatabase users > users.sql

这样,系统就会在当前目录下生成一个名为 users.sql 的 SQL 脚本文件,其中包含了 users 表的结构和数据。

关系图

erDiagram
    USERS {
        INT id
        VARCHAR(50) username
        VARCHAR(50) email
    }

在上面的关系图中,我们展示了一个简单的用户表 USERS,包含了 idusernameemail 三个字段。

饼状图

pie
    title 数据库表的字段分布
    "id": 30
    "username": 40
    "email": 30

饼状图展示了数据库表中字段的分布情况,username 占比最大,占据了 40%,idemail 分别占据了 30%。

通过以上步骤,我们可以使用 mysqldump 命令轻松地导出数据库中的单张表,方便我们在需要时进行备份或迁移。希望本文对你有所帮助!